About the artwork

Робота є частиною серії «Abandoned Flowers» («Полишені квіти»). Кожен мандрівник (біженець), який залишив свій дім, залишив там своє життя. Полишені квіти є алегоричним тлом стану душі під час вимушеної подорожі.

Tsoi Nikita
Date of birth: 1991
Place of residence: Kyiv

Nikita Tsoi was born in 1991 in Kyiv, Ukraine.

He graduated from two art schools, the National Academy of Fine Arts and Architecture, and the Kyiv Academy of Media Arts.

The artist works on constructing the historical narrative of the post-ideological climate of recent decades. He views the individual as a bearer of ideological consciousness, seeking its own basis and exploring its acceptance and dissonance with itself. This is a search for the boundary between the anatomical and anti-anatomical, between truth and the distortion of truth.
